Boaz Brown was born in 1641 in Concord, Middlesex, Massachusetts, United States, the child of Thomas Browne And Bridget Bateman. Boaz Brown married Dinah Spalding, and had children including Edward Brown, Eleazer Brown 1676 1755, Mary Stearns, Mercy Everett. Boaz Brown passed away in 1724 in Concord, Middlesex County, Massachusetts, United States of America.
